The Bill Pollock Show–Brad Smith’s remarkable game on this date for #Mizzou – #Royals and #STLCards fans love their baseball on TV (PODCAST)

October 11, 2017 By Bill Pollock

Former Mizzou Tigers quarterback Brad Smith was named to the 2017 SEC Football Legends Class.  Smith helped turn around the program for Gary Pinkel…he left holding 69 school records and became the first player in Division I to throw for 8,000 yards and rush for 4,000 in a career and he broke the NCAA record for most career rushing yards by a quarterback.  However, in my mind, Smith will be remembered for one game and how fitting that it came on this date exactly 14 years ago.

No playoff baseball in Missouri this year, but the Kansas City and St. Louis markets raked when it came to fans watching baseball on TV.
